On Jun 2, 2009, at 5:28 AM, Jo Rhett wrote:

> I reported this message display bug about 3 months ago, Kevin agreed
> with the fix, but it's still present in 3.8.3.  Without this fix, if
> you click "Show" next to an outgoing mail message, regardless of your
> preference settings, text paragraphs are a single long line.

I don't recall agreeing with the fix, but I did ask for it to end up  
in the
bug tracker so it could be tracked.

Its currently slated for review for 3.8.4
http://rt3.fsck.com/Ticket/Display.html?id=13230

As I recall, during triage for 3.8.3 I couldn't immediately replicate
the problem you were solving so we left it for further review when
we had a little more time to replicate.

> --- ShowEmailRecord.html_orig   2009-02-23 16:55:17.000000000 -0800
> +++ ShowEmailRecord.html        2009-02-23 16:56:22.000000000 -0800
>  -65,7 +65,7
>  my $show;
>  $show = sub {
>      my $attach = shift;
> -    $m->out( '<div id="body"><pre style="padding: 2em;">' );
> +    $m->out( '<div id="body" style="white-space: pre-wrap; padding:
> 2em;">' );
>      $m->out( $m->interp->apply_escapes( $attach->Headers, 'h' ) );
>      $m->out( "\n\n" );
>      if ( $attach->ContentType =~ m{^multipart/}i ) {
>  -76,7 +76,7
>      } else {
>          $show_content->( $attach );
>      }
> -    $m->out( '</pre></div>' );
> +    $m->out( '</div>' );
>  };
